#a9c9bc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#a9c9bc is composed of 66.3% red, 78.8% green and 73.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 15.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 6.5% yellow and 21.2% black. It has a hue angle of 155.6 degrees, a saturation of 22.9% and a lightness of 72.5%. #a9c9bc color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#539379. Closest websafe color is: #99cccc.

#a9c9bc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#a9c9bc has RGB values of R:169, G:201, B:188 and CMYK values of C:0.16, M:0, Y:0.06, K:0.21. Its decimal value is 11127228.
